1.2.1 RF functionalities 
The RF functionalities comply with the Phase II EGSM 900/GSM 1800 
recommendation. The frequencies are: 
• 
Rx (EGSM 900): 925 to 960 MHz  Rx (GSM 1800): 1805 to 1880 MH  
• 
Tx (EGSM 900): 880 to 915 MHz  Tx (GSM 1800): 1710 to 1785 MHz 
The RF part is based on a specific dual band chip including: 
• 
Low-if Receiver 
• 
Dual RF synthesizer 
• 
Digital if to Baseband Converter 
• 
Offset PLL transmitter 
• 
1 (logarithmic) PA controller 
• 
Dual band PA module 
1.2.2 Baseband functionalities 
The digital part of the WISMO Quik Q2403 Series is composed of a PHILIPS-
VLSI chip (ONE C GSM/GPRS Kernel). This chipset is using a 0,25 µm mixed 
technology CMOS, which allows massive integration as well as low current 
consumption. 
1.3 Firmware 
WISMO Quik Q2403 Series is designed to be integrated into various types of 
applications such as handsets or vertical applications (telemetry, multimedia, 
automotive,…). 
For vertical applications, the firmware offers a set of AT commands to control 
the module. With this standard software, some interfaces of the module are 
not available since they are dependent on the peripheral devices connected to 
the module. They are the LCD interface and the SPI bus.
